Simsbury Camera Club to Kick off 60th Year
Public invited to Simsbury Camera Club Meeting

The Simsbury Camera Club will be kicking off their 60th year on Wednesday, September 16th at 7:00 pm in the Old Courtroom at Eno Hall located at 754 Hopmeadow St, Simsbury. Current members, guests and prospective members are invited for refreshments and to hear about the interesting guests and programs planned for the coming year. The first meeting will also include a slide presentation of the digital image competition results for August (nature category) and September (open and water categories). The subject of the after the break presentation will be ‘How to set up your Nikon or Canon camera’.
The Simsbury Camera Club is a nonprofit organization dedicated to enhancing the photographic skills of its members from the beginner to advanced level. Regular monthly meetings are held at 7:00 pm on the 3rd Wednesday of the month form September through May at Eno Hall. Educational programs are held on the 1st Wednesday of the month at the Simsbury Public Library at 6:30 pm. All meetings and programs are free and open to the public.
